Recently, the Crypto Assets market has seen significant developments. On August 23, several well-known asset management companies including Grayscale, Bitwise, Canary, CoinShares, Franklin, 21Shares, and WisdomTree updated their Spot XRP ETF application documents. This series of actions once again highlights the strong desire in the financial community to obtain approval from the SEC for listing.



Industry experts believe that this wave of concentrated updates is likely a response to the SEC's feedback. Although this development was anticipated, it is still seen as a positive signal. It is worth noting that the updated documents show changes in some fund structures. The new applications allow for creation using XRP or cash, while supporting redemption in cash or physical form, no longer limited to the previous cash-only operation model.

This change reflects the flexibility of asset management companies in product design, likely aimed at increasing the appeal and practicality of ETFs.
